Grindstone-Lost-Muddy Creek Watershed Dam C-36
Grindstone-Lost-Muddy Creek Watershed Dam C-36 is a dam in Polk Township, DeKalb County, Missouri. Grindstone-Lost-Muddy Creek Watershed Dam C-36 is situated nearby to the village King City.- Type: Dam
- Description: dam in DeKalb County, Missouri, United States of America
- Also known as: “C-36 Dam”

King City is a city in southwest Gentry County, Missouri, United States. The population was 799 at the 2020 census. King City is situated 4 miles west of Grindstone-Lost-Muddy Creek Watershed Dam C-36.

Berlin is an unincorporated community in Gentry County, Missouri, in the United States. It is situated 4.5 miles north of Fairport and 9 mile east of King City. Berlin is situated 6 miles east of Grindstone-Lost-Muddy Creek Watershed Dam C-36.
